网页设计入门<一>
俗话说:技多不压身。实习周,网页设计是之一,边学边总结。。。
本次网页设计基于Adobe Dreamweaver CS6开发平台,根据实习老师的暴力指导,为什么说暴力呢?
没有基础,没有预告,打开软件就开始指导,上边说的风声水起,下边听的云里来雾里去,但是既来之,则学之,接受完暴力指导,就有如下代码:
以下为代码前半部分,文字不算注释,只是辅助理解加上去的:
<html>
<head>
<title>Chance Wen</title> /*网页标题*/
<style type="text/css"> body{
margin:0px; /*外边距*/
padding:0px; /*内边距*/
background-image:url(images/background.gif); /*背景图片*/
background-repeat:repeat-x; /*背景图片按X轴复制展开*/
background-color:#cc9;} /*背景颜色*/ #con{
width:700px; /*在body下的一个盒子,背景中最大的一个盒子,可以存放本例中所有内容*/
margin:60px auto 0px; /*60px是外边距,auto400px是上下自由,测试,似乎是下变化*/
position:relative;} /*相对左上角,上下自由增加,基本就是下增加了*/ #pro{ /*装四张图片的盒子*/
list-style-type:none; /*去掉照片的点*/
padding:0; /*内外边距相对于CON的盒子来说*/
margin:0;}
#pro li{ /*盒子中图片的属性处理*/
float:left; /*水平图片*/
padding:4px;} /*图片之间的内边距为8*/ #pro li.last{ /*pro盒子中最后一个图片处理*/
position:absolute; /*绝对可覆盖*/
right:0;} h1{ /*插一张图片*/
background-image:url(images/logo.png);
background-repeat:no-repeat;
height:191px;
width:137px;
position:absolute;
top:100px;
left:270px;
} #intro{ /*装了文字的盒子,后有<div>...</div>之间的东西*/
width:180px; /*设置盒子属性*/
position:absolute;
right:100px;
font-size:12px; /*字体大小*/
line-height:17px; /*行距*/
font-family:Arial, Helvetica, sans-serif;} /*字体*/ #mainmenu{ /*有超链接的盒子属性*/
list-style-type:none;
margin:0 0 0 20px;
padding:0;
font-size:12px;} #mainmenu a{ /*盒子中的内容,颜色,粗细,下划线*/
color:#FFFFFF;
font-weight:bold;
text-decoration:none;} #mainmenu a:hover{ /*内容聚焦,以及聚焦以后的颜色是黑色*/
color:black;}
以下是完整代码:
<html><head>
<title>Chance Wen</title>
<style type="text/css"> body{
margin:0px;
padding:0px;
background-image:url(images/background.gif);
background-repeat:repeat-x;
background-color:#cc9;} #con{
width:700px;
margin:60px auto 0px;
position:relative;} #pro{
list-style-type:none;
padding:0;
margin:0;}
#pro li{
float:left;
padding:4px;} #pro li.last{
position:absolute;
right:0;} h1{
background-image:url(images/logo.png);
background-repeat:no-repeat;
height:191px;
width:137px;
position:absolute;
top:100px;
left:270px;
} #intro{
width:180px;
position:absolute;
right:100px;
font-size:12px;
line-height:17px;
font-family:Arial, Helvetica, sans-serif;} #mainmenu{
list-style-type:none;
margin:0 0 0 20px;
padding:0;
font-size:12px;} #mainmenu a{
color:#FFFFFF;
font-weight:bold;
text-decoration:none;} #mainmenu a:hover{
color:black;} </style>
</head> <body> <div id="con">
<ul id="pro">
<li><img src="images/photo-1.jpg"/></li>
<li><img src="images/photo-2.jpg"/></li>
<li><img src="images/photo-3.jpg"/></li>
<li class="last"><img src="images/photo-4.jpg"/></li>
</ul>
<h1></h1> <div id="intro">
<p>For more than 20 years, Chance Wen's photographs have brought incredible images of landscape to people around the world.</p> <ul id="mainmenu">
<li>[ <a href="#">United States</a><span class="STYLE1"> ]</span></li>
<li>[ <a href="#">Canada</a><span class="STYLE2"> ]</span></li>
<li>[ <a href="#">China</a> <span class="STYLE3">]</span></li>
<li>[ <a href="#">Austrila</a> ]</li>
<li>[ <a href="#">United Kingdom</a> ]</li>
</ul> <p>Hardcover with jacket. More than 200 color photos.</p>
<p>Tel:+86-10-98765432<br />
Fax:+86-10-98765432</p>
<p>e-mail:support@artech.cn</p> </div>
</div>
</body> </html>
以及得到的网页效果展示:
大体框架很明白,给定网页内容,根据规定排版,建立多种盒子,以及盒子各种属性的设置等,辅助完成设计,添加超链接、背景色等,再加上网页设计的语言也算不上编程语
言,所以学起来希望不会太难,凡事基础很重要,接下来逐步学习,总结,分享!
赐教!
网页设计入门<一>的更多相关文章
- HTML 5网页设计入门必读(书)
今天看了一本由人民邮电出版社出版.邢薇薇 郭俊飞 王雪翻译的<HTML 5网页设计入门必读>,在此整理一下知识点,以及写一些自己的读后感. 本书的开章还是和大部分HTML 5书籍一样,用极 ...
- 新编html网页设计从入门到精通 (龙马工作室) pdf扫描版
新编html网页设计从入门到精通共分为21章,全面系统地讲解了html的发展历史及4.0版的新特性.基本概念.设计原则.文件结构.文件属性标记.用格式标记进行页面排版.使用图像装饰页面.超链接的使用. ...
- 新编html网页设计从入门到精通 (龙马工作室) pdf扫描版
新编html网页设计从入门到精通共分为21章,全面系统地讲解了html的发展历史及4.0版的新特性.基本概念.设计原则.文件结构.文件属性标记.用格式标记进行页面排版.使用图像装饰页面.超链接的使用. ...
- 网页设计,Access入门 2010,数学
网页设计(表格) 创建表格:插入---表格---设置表格大小---确定.(按Ctrl键可多选单元格) 插入图片在表格:光标在单元格---插入---图像---选择图像---确定. 表格属性:属性(屏幕下 ...
- HTML5+CSS3的响应式网页设计:自动适应屏幕宽度
这几天都在修改博客上面的样式.本来用的是d83.0的模板.自己又修改了许多地方,其中自己修改的一些地方在手机里面显示的效果不是很理想,于是想改成自适应的效果.对CSS3不是特别的熟练,只能去网上找找案 ...
- HTML&CSS精选笔记_HTML与CSS网页设计概述
HTML与CSS网页设计概述 Web基本概念 认识网页 网页主要由文字.图像和超链接等元素构成.当然,除了这些元素,网页中还可以包含音频.视频以及Flash等. 名词解释 Internet网络 就是通 ...
- HTML 5+CSS 3网页设计经典范例 (李俊民,黄盛奎) 随书光盘
<html 5+css 3网页设计经典范例(附cd光盘1张)>共分为18章,涵盖了html 5和css3中各方面的技术知识.主要内容包括html 5概述.html 5与html 4的区别. ...
- Dreamweaver Flash Photoshop网页设计综合应用 (智云科技) [iso] 1.86G
全书共15章,主要包括网页制作基础.Dreamweaver CC网页制作.Photoshop CC网页图像设计.Flash CC网页动画设计以及综合案例实战5个部分.通过本书的学习,不仅能让读者学会三 ...
- 网页设计与开发——HTML、CSS、JavaScript (王津涛) pdf扫描版
网页设计与开发——html.css.javascript从网页制作实际出发,除了详细地介绍html页面制作.css样式控制和javascript动态程序之外,还介绍了html 5.全书共分15章,各章 ...
随机推荐
- jquery 记住账号 记住密码
<body> <label><input type="checkbox" onclick="loginBtn_user()" /& ...
- 用css以写代码形式画一个皮卡丘
我的个人网站是通过写代码的形式来形成一个网站的,前一阵子在某个大神的github上看到他用写代码的形式来完成一个皮卡丘,于是心血来潮花了半个小时,也完成了一个作品. 这其中涉及到的知识点也不是很复杂, ...
- Bzoj4869: [Shoi2017]相逢是问候
题面 传送门 Sol 摆定理 \[ a^b\equiv \begin{cases} a^{b\%\phi(p)}~~~~~~~~~~~gcd(a,p)=1\\ a^b~~~~~~~~~~~~~~~~~ ...
- [BZOJ2296] [POJ Challenge] 随机种子
Description 1tthinking除了随机算法,其他什么都不会.但是他还是可以ac很多题目,他用的是什么呢?他会选择一个好的随机种子,然后输出答案.往往他选择的一个好的种子可以有99%的概率 ...
- ajax错误处理 500错误
在使用ajax请求的时候 ,如果服务器返回的是500错误,或者其他非正常的http错误状态码时 会提示下面的错误 而我们需要把错误信息处理出来 $.ajax({ type:'get', url:&q ...
- sqlserver存储过程及临时表在统计中的应用
use ResourceShare --统计使用情况 alter PROCEDURE StaSheryUse @start datetime, @end datetime, @orgId int AS ...
- java 向上转型与向下转型
转型是在继承的基础上而言的,继承是面向对象语言中,代码复用的一种机制,通过继承,子类可以复用父类的功能,如果父类不能满足当前子类的需求,则子类可以重写父类中的方法来加以扩展. 向上转型:子类引用的对象 ...
- MSIL实用指南-局部变量的声明、保存和加载
这一篇讲解方法内的局部变量是怎么声明.怎样保存.怎样加载的. 声明局部变量声明用ILGenerator的DeclareLocal方法,参数是局部变量的数据类型,得到一个局部变量对应的创建类LocalB ...
- iOS 神秘而又强大的传感器系统 (附demo)
iOS中的各种传感器: 随着科技的发展,机器感知人的行为!Goole的无人驾驶汽车到李彦宏的无人驾汽车,都带入了各种计算及传感. 为了研究自然现象和制造劳动工具,人类必须了解外界的各类信息.了解外界信 ...
- WordPress菜单“显示选项”无法显示的解决办法
比较新版本的WordPress会出现点击“外观”——“菜单”右上角的“显示选项”无法打开的问题,而老版本的就没有这个问题,后台的其他页面中的这个 功能都可以正常使用,看来问题是因为中文版WordPre ...